Just to be clear what tractor do own? B2650 or L2650???

Category I (Cat I) is usually tractors below 40 HP and Cat II is greater than 40 HP.

There is sometimes some confusion between the statement "my tractor is Cat I or CAT II". As Caden says yours is "typically Cat I" - but what does that actually mean? The lower arms of the 3 PT have a ball with a hole that swivel and accepts the pins of the equipment connected. This would be the "typical Cat I" he refers to.

3-point-hitch-diagram.jpg

The other issue when talking about QH's is the type of lower hooks (for lack of a better term) that the connected equipment fits into - see the circled bits. This is "typically" Cat II and may or may not require a Cat II to Cat I adaptor bushings to reduce slop and rattling depending on the type of pins your connected equipment has.

The arrows point to the connecting pins that are typically Cat I. It is unlikely that your tractor has Cat II but if for some reason you do then make sure those pins are Cat II in whatever you buy. I imagine you could buy adaptors for those as well if you had to.
